First i have to say, wrong music for that crowd. LOL ! Maybe he's just trying to convince himself that he could do dance music in a large room. Doesn't sound like it to me.
I just don't see anything so amazing for $1200. And whats the big deal about battery power. I'm sure every venue this guy DJs in has plugs.
As in the other threat about this, so many other choices for less money that would do a better job.
Good system for a street busker with a guitar but beyond that not so much.
But if your in love with the BOSE name go for it and enjoy.
